![](https://img-blog.csdnimg.cn/20201225215408543.png?x-oss-process=image/resize,m_fixed,h_224,w_224)
redis
文章平均质量分 90
redis
BIGmustang
路漫漫其修远兮,吾将上下而求索
展开
-
Redis中的Scan命令的使用
Redis中的Scan命令的使用Redis中有一个经典的问题,在巨大的数据量的情况下,做类似于查找符合某种规则的Key的信息,这里就有两种方式,一是keys命令,简单粗暴,由于Redis单线程这一特性,keys命令是以阻塞的方式执行的,keys是以遍历的方式实现的复杂度是 O(n),Redis库中的key越多,查找实现代价越大,产生的阻塞时间越长。二是scan命令,以非阻塞的方式实现key值的查找,绝大多数情况下是可以替代keys命令的,可选性更强以下写入100000条key***:value***原创 2021-12-02 10:54:14 · 2661 阅读 · 0 评论 -
redis群集搭建---哨兵模式(理论加实例)
1、哨兵简介:Redis SentinelSentinel(哨兵)是用于监控redis集群中Master状态的工具,其已经被集成在redis2.4+的版本中是Redis官方推荐的高可用性(HA)解决方案。2、作用1):Master状态检测2):如果Master异常,则会进行Master-Slave切换,将其中一个Slave作为Master,将之前的Master作为Slave3):Master-Slave切换后,sentinel.conf的监控目标会随之调换3、工作模式1):每个Sentinel原创 2020-11-11 23:11:09 · 253 阅读 · 1 评论 -
redis群集环境搭建(一)
redis群集环境搭建原创 2020-09-09 22:21:15 · 280 阅读 · 0 评论 -
redis集群基础命令与扩容命令
文章目录一:redis基础命令1、创建集群:2、远程登录redis数据库:3、查看集群信息:4、查看集群slave、slot、key分布信息情况二:redis扩容命令1、将redis节点添加到集群:进入集群中一个节点添加2、删除节点:3、迁移redis槽位4、迁移后检测各个节点槽的均衡性5、为扩容的主节点添加从节点6、平衡各节点槽数量前言一:redis基础命令1、创建集群:redis-cli --cluster create --cluster-replicas 1 节点IP地址1:端口… 节点IP原创 2020-09-09 18:44:00 · 482 阅读 · 0 评论 -
centos7上部署 redis 及基本操作命令 和 服务优化
文章目录前言一、为什么使用 Redis?二、Redis在项目中的应用场景三、redis部署3.1 关闭防火墙3.2 安装软件3.3 查看服务开启3.4 基本操作命令3.5 具体操作3.5.1 进入数据库3.5.2 连接数据库3.5.3 显示键名3.5.4 删除键名3.5.5 * ? 的 应用3.5.6 修改键名字3.5.7 数据库的切换,总共16个库,0-153.5.8 设置超时时间20S ,超时文件自动消失3.5.9 压力测试,发送50个并发连接,10000个请求测试性能3.6读写测试原创 2020-09-08 20:01:35 · 407 阅读 · 0 评论